The elevated neutral-to-earth voltage (NEV), and the related phenomenon called stray voltage, is analyzed in multigrounded distribution systems. Elevated NEV is typically caused by fundamental frequency currents returning to the source via the neutral conductor and earth. However, harmonic distortion is also found to contribute to elevated NEV. A multiphase harmonic load flow algorithm is developed to examine the effects of various factors on the NEV, including unsymmetrical system configuration, load unbalance and harmonic injection. A reduced-order dynamic model is presented and experimentally validated to demonstrate the use of cooled exhaust gas recirculation to alleviate the tradeoff between nitric oxide reduction and performance preservation in a small displacement diesel engine. Exhaust gas recirculation (EGR) is an effective method for internal combustion engine oxides of nitrogen (NOx) reduction, but its thermal throttling diminishes power efficiency. The capacity to cool exhaust gases prior to merging with intake air may achieve the desired pollutant effect while minimizing engine performance losses.

Haptics is the science of applying touch (tactile) sensation and control to interaction with computer applications. The devices used to interact with computer applications are known as haptic interfaces. These devices sense some form of human movement, be it finger, head, hand or body movement and receive feedback from computer applications in form of felt sensations to the limbs or other parts of the human body. Examples of haptic interfaces range from force feedback joysticks/controllers in video game consoles to tele-operative surgery. This thesis deals with haptic interfaces involving hand movements.
